1. Turn Off Key Water Shutoff
Pipelines can rupture because of cold temps, high pressure, obstruction, hot water heater concerns, and also various other variables. No matter the cause, you must act rapidly to guarantee permeable house materials, appliances, as well as furnishings do not absorb the water, causing damages. Turn off the primary shutoff before you do any kind of cleaning to make certain water stops gathering. Eliminating the water source is simple, and also it is something you can do on your own. As for the burst pipe, require emergency plumbing services to fix it as soon as possible.
2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ker
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can create injuries or deaths. Keep the power off up until excess water is gone.
3. Relocate Essential Wet Times
When it pertains to saving your home furnishings and also devices, time is of the essence. You need to relocate whatever sharpen personal belongings you can from the affected location to a dry place. This discourages additional damages since the longer they take in water, the a lot more comprehensive the trouble.
4. Document the Degree of Damage
Keep in mind of all the damage inflicted by the ruptured pipe. You can document notes, take photos, as well as collect video clips. This is a wonderful means to provide evidence to accumulate cases on your home insurance protection. With documentation, you can likewise obtain a clear image of the degree of the damages.
5. Remove Water ASAP
You have to get rid of excess water as soon as possible. Must there be a large qu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for extraction. When minimal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Location
Concentrate on drying out the influenced areas. If the climate is pleasant, open windows and doors to increase air movement. You can likewise set up electrical fans as well as put them in the strongest setup. A dehumidifier likewise operates in getting moisture to prevent mildew and mold and mildews.
7. Deal with Experts
When you endure considerable water damage because of emergency flooding from a ruptured pipeline, you can collaborate with a remediation expert to restore as well as renovate your house. Above all, don't neglect to call a trusted plumber to take care of the ruptured pipeline as well as examine the rest of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will be provided ineffective.

For starters, storms do not simply come without a caution. Weather stations check the ambience everyday. If a tornado is feasible, they will provide 2 kinds of cautions:
Storm watch-- is provided when there is a feasible tornado in your area.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, over cast sky, an abnormally windy day and also some rainfall. The tornado might or may not come, yet this is the time to keep tuned to your regional radio for news and updates.
Storm warning-- is released when a storm is headed toward your location. By that time, the streets might be swamped and web traffic is poor. You do not desire to be caught in your cars and truck in bad weather condition.
Snowstorm-- generally happens in winter months as well as suggests heavy snow, strong winds and also wind cool. When a caution is released, stay clear of taking a trip as long as possible and also remain inside your home. Things don't constantly go bad during tornados, however climate is unforeseeable as well as anything can take place. To help you get ready for a tornado emergency, right here are a few ideas:
Dress up.
Use sufficient garments to keep yourself warm. Warm may not be offered in your home so get extra coats and also coverings to keep your body temperature level complet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ks as well as boots ready.
Have food all set.
Emergency arrangements are a have to throughout tornado emergency situations. If the storm gets as well poor and the roads are swamped, you will certainly have a problem going out to the grocery store stores.
Maintain containers of water helpful. Tidy water may be difficult ahead by throughout really negative problems as well as the worst thing you can do is struggle with dehydration because you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at least one gallon for every single individual per day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.
Fill up the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ing and also fl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your tub, water containers as well as pails with water. If you have small children in your home, take precautions by covering deep containers as well as keeping youngsters away from the shower room unless necessary.
Emergency package
Have a medical or very first set all set and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It needs to contain disinfectants,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also essential medications. It's also a great concept to have one more set in your auto.
If anyone in your family is under unique drug, see to it you have adequate products to last up until after the storm is over and medicine stores are open.
Lights off
Expect power failures throughout storm emergency situations. You won't have any kind of electricity, so stock on candles, flashlights and also emergency lights. Have extra fresh batteries as well as suits in case you go out.
If you can not turn on the television,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your area. Media will certainly keep track of the tornado and will certainly keep you updated.
You could need warm water throughout the period when power is not yet offered, so maintain a small storage tank of gas about just in case. Your outside barbecue grill will certainly do nicely.
Get an alternating sanctuary.
If you assume your house will experience significantly, it's a excellent suggestion to consider an alternate shelter. It could be an evacuation facility or one more home or building that is much safer. Ensure you have sufficient gas in your tank in case you need to leave your house and also step some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have far better opportunities of being risk-free and completely dry.
